Thought for the day:
Let's all remember to take the time to LIVE!!!
A Friend of mine opened his wife's drawer and picked up a silk paper wrapped
package: "This," he said, "isn't any ordinary package." He unwrapped the box and stared at both the silk paper and the box. "She got this the first time we went to New York, 8 or 9 years ago... She has never put it on. She was saving it for a special occasion. Every day in your life is a special occasion." I still think those words changed my life. Now I read more and clean less. I sit on the porch without worrying about anything. I'd spend more time with my family and less at work. I understood that life should be a source of experience to be lived up to not survived through. I no longer keep anything. I use crystal glasses every day... I'll wear new clothes to the supermarket if I feel like it. I don't save my special perfume for special occasions. I use it whenever I want to. The words "Someday..." and "One Day..." are fading away from my dictionary. If it's worth seeing, listening or doing I want to see, listen, or do it now... I don't know what my friend's wife would have done if she knew she wouldn't be there the next morning. This nobody can tell. I think she might have called her relatives and closest friends. She might call old friends to make peace over past quarrels. I'd like to think she would go out for Chinese, her favorite food. It's these small things that I would regret not doing if I knew my time had come. Each day, each hour, each minute is special. Live for today, for tomorrow is promised to no one.
